二维码信息的承载方法、获取方法、装置、设备和介质制造方法及图纸

技术编号:37842528 阅读:30 留言:0更新日期:2023-06-14 09:47
本申请实施例提供一种二维码信息的承载方法、获取方法、装置、设备和介质,以解决现有技术中存在的如何使得用户在获取视频文件的同时能够获取到与视频文件相关联的二维码的问题。该方法包括:获取与视频文件相关联的二维码的若干像素单元各自在二维码中的灰度值和位置信息;所述若干像素单元的数量,不少于所述二维码的容错率对应的二维码面积包含的像素单元的数量;根据若干像素单元各自的灰度值和位置信息,生成分别用于承载若干像素单元中指定数量的像素单元的灰度值和位置信息的条码;采用将条码合成到视频文件包含的图像帧中的方式,将视频文件转换为包含条码的目标视频文件。频文件。频文件。

【技术实现步骤摘要】
二维码信息的承载方法、获取方法、装置、设备和介质


[0001]本申请涉及二维码
,尤其涉及一种二维码信息的承载方法、获取方法、装置、设备和计算机可读存储介质。

技术介绍

[0002]二维码,是指用某种特定的几何图形按一定规律在平面(二维方向上)分布的、黑白相间的、记录数据符号(每个数据符号称之为标识点或码点)的信息的图形,一般通过静态图片的方式进行展示。对于二维码所承载的信息,通常可以通过对二维码进行扫描、拍照或截屏的方式进行识别。
[0003]二维码的出现给人们的生活带来了极大的便利,它可以在诸多场景下用于信息承载与传递。
[0004]对于用户获取视频文件的场景,比如,接收视频文件进行播放、拍摄/生成视频文件进行上传等场景,如何将与视频文件相关联的二维码——比如承载有视频图像中商品信息的二维码、承载视频原创者信息的二维码、承载有用于对视频文件进行签名的信息的二维码等——加入到视频文件中,以便用户在获取视频文件的同时能够获取到与视频文件相关联的二维码,是现有技术亟需解决的技术问题。

技术实现思路

[0005本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种二维码信息的承载方法,其特征在于,包括:获取与视频文件相关联的二维码的若干像素单元各自在所述二维码中的灰度值和位置信息;所述若干像素单元的数量,不少于所述二维码的容错率对应的二维码面积包含的像素单元的数量;根据所述若干个像素单元各自的所述灰度值和所述位置信息,生成分别用于承载所述若干像素单元中指定数量的像素单元的所述灰度值和所述位置信息的条码;采用将所述条码合成到所述视频文件包含的图像帧中的方式,将所述视频文件转换为包含所述条码的目标视频文件。2.根据权利要求1所述的方法,其特征在于,采用将所述条码合成到所述视频文件包含的图像帧中的方式,将所述视频文件转换为包含所述条码的目标视频文件,包括:根据所述二维码的容错率,和/或,用于传输所述目标视频文件的网络的传输丢帧率,确定对于所述条码的重复部署次数;根据所述重复部署次数,将各个所述条码合成到所述视频文件包含的图像帧中;其中,将各个所述条码合成到所述视频文件包含的图像帧中的次数,等于所述重复部署次数。3.根据权利要求2所述的方法,其特征在于,将各个所述条码合成到所述视频文件依次的图像帧中,包括:针对各个所述条码,分别执行:确定将要与该条码进行合成的相应图像帧中的目标区域内的像素的平均颜色值和平均灰度值;所述目标区域,为所述相应图像帧中用于显示该条码的区域;根据所述平均颜色值调整该条码的图形底色,根据所述平均灰度值调整该条码包含的像素单元的灰度值,以得到调整后的该条码;将调整后的该条码合成到所述相应图像帧中。4.根据权利要求1所述的方法,其特征在于,针对各个所述条码,分别执行:将调整后的该条码合成到所述相应图像帧中,包括:按照各个所述条码对应的像素单元在所述二维码中的排列顺序,将调整后的各个所述条码依次合成到所述视频文件依次包含的图像帧中。5.根据权利要求4所述的方法,其特征在于,按照各个所述条码对应的像素单元在所述二维码中的排列顺序,将调整后的各个所述条码依次合成到所述视频文件依次包含的图像帧中,包括:按照所述排列顺序,以及每个所述图像帧最多合成调整后的一个所述条码的合成规则,将调整后的各个所述条码依次合成到所述视频文件依次包含的图像帧中。6.一种二维码信息的获取方法,其特征在于,包括:获取目标视频文件包含的图像帧中合成的条码;所述条码,承载有二维码的像素单元在所述二维码中的...

【专利技术属性】
技术研发人员:陈川波吴寒雪
申请(专利权)人:中国人民财产保险股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1